1) Ipoh, Malaysia

Picture: Aryl Je

Malaysia is known for the diversity of its people and, of course, the food. Ipoh is the capital city of the Perak state in Malaysia. Its food and white coffee are the reasons to visit this city. Aside from that, Ipoh is rich with hills and caves, which will become your new adventure to discover. Not only that, the architecture of certain places is amazing. Try out these places in Ipoh:

  • Chinese temples of Perak Tong, Sam Poh Tong, Kek Lok Tong
  • Railway Station to the Birch Clock Tower
  • Town hall
  • Old post office

2) Isaan, Thailand

Picture: Travelfish

Isaan, Thailand is rich with its historic architecture, dramatic landscapes, and culinary delights. Isaan shared borders with Laos and Cambodia, thus, the cuisine, language, historic sites, and festivals are influenced by the two places. Make sure not to miss out on these places while visiting Isan:

  • Khmer ruins of Phenom Rung in Buriram
  • Mountainous national parks in Loei
  • “Three Whale Rock” in Bueng Kam
  • Bronze Age artifacts in the UNESCO-listed Ban Chiang Archeological Site in Udon Thani.

3) Leshan, China

Picture: BBC

You can not get over Leshan’s atmospheric view and the food! Most people come to Leshan to see the Giant Buddha, which is the biggest and tallest statue. Aside from that, Sichuan city, and the scenic Mount Emei. Feeling hungry after your adventure? Try out this food:

  • chilled bobo chicken
  • jellied tofu
  • Qiaojiao beef
  • steamed meat with rice powder

4) Skardu, Pakistan

Picture: Zameen

Skardu district is in Pakistan’s Gilgit Baltistan region. Skardu will amaze you with its beautiful, and high mountains! Aside from that, you can also befriend nature, like birds and butterflies. You would not feel disappointed by these places:

  • Deosai National Park
  • Sarfaranga Desert

5) Nikko, Japan

Picture: Mattador Network

Nikko is a small city that is rich in Shinto culture. It is spot-on for nature lovers. 

  • Nikko National Park

The park is also home to some of Japan’s famous natural hot springs, making Nikko an ideal autumn or winter destination. From north Tokyo, it only takes 150km to reach Nikko.

6) Dalat, Vietnam

Picture: The Crazy Tourist

Local Vienamese loves to visit Dalat. Dalat’s fresh mountain air and its pine forest become the reason why the locals visit there. Aside from that, Dalat will reveal to you its architecture from the French colonial times, with its twisting stairwells and whimsical sculptures. 

7) Meghalaya, India

Picture: Fodors Travel Guide

Meghalaya is located in northeast India. Meghalaya means “abode in the clouds.” To see the peaceful, and beautiful landscapes, require you to have a permit. Nevertheless, you won’t be disappointed with its scenery. The place holds a record of being the wettest place on Earth.
